This patch was applied to bpf/bpf-next.git (master) by Daniel Borkmann <daniel@iogearbox.net>:
On Thu, 21 Jul 2022 08:13:19 -0400 you wrote: > From: Xu Kuohai <xukuohai@huawei.com> > > dummy_tramp() uses "lr" to refer to the x30 register, but some assembler > does not recognize "lr" and reports a build failure: > > /tmp/cc52xO0c.s: Assembler messages: > /tmp/cc52xO0c.s:8: Error: operand 1 should be an integer register -- `mov lr,x9' > /tmp/cc52xO0c.s:7: Error: undefined symbol lr used as an immediate value > make[2]: *** [scripts/Makefile.build:250: arch/arm64/net/bpf_jit_comp.o] Error 1 > make[1]: *** [scripts/Makefile.build:525: arch/arm64/net] Error 2 > > [...]
